After being framed for a terrorist attack at the Fantasy Fighting Games, gamer Sofi Snow is determined to find her missing younger brother, Shilo, who is believed by everyone to have been killed during the bombing.

Joined by her ex-boyfriend, the black-eyed, Spanish-speaking Ambassador Miguel Perez, brown-skinned Sofi has infiltrated the planet Delon in an attempt to find Shilo. The Delonese, an alien species who have parked their planet next to Earth’s moon, have been using human children in medical experiments in exchange for their technologically advanced cures, a secret agreement orchestrated by Corp 30 CEO Inola, who is also Sofi’s estranged mother. While searching for Shilo, Sofi and Miguel discover a horrifying secret that could have catastrophic results for Earth’s citizens and the Delonese. While Inola uses her security forces to track Sofi, time is running out, as the Delonese have captured both her and Miguel. In this sequel to The Evaporation of Sofi Snow (2017), Weber takes a darker tone, delving into alien abduction, experimentation on children, the machinations of power-hungry politicians, and black-market corruption.

Though it is a little challenging to sort through the abundance of slick, clichéd politicians, this is a well-paced page-turner

. (Science fiction. 14-18)
